    Re leffin' Yaad...That does not have to be a negative. In fact it can (for some evolved folks) be converted into a huge positive. Living abroad gives you broader perspectives, experiences and relationships one can leverage as well as being relieved of the petty/small-minded, stultifying environment in JA... That nexus can spark Big Ideas and change in Jamaica

    Stoni that is exactly how the self-government movement got a spark out of New York City's Jamaican immigrant community, the Jamaica Progressive League etc. When that was linked with NW Manley & his Drumblair/JC Crew...Self-government was achieved...then Independence (sorta )

    NYC is also where Garvey was able to flower into a worldwide phenomenon and Lion of the Black Nation...until crucified by Babylon

    So Stoni living abroad is no impediment to contributing to JA....and can be a BIG ADVANTAGE...That's where the incipient STEM Revolution currently flowing out of NYC comes into play. I would have though a man of your exposure & perspicacity would have realized this...mah bad
